Will they survive? Will the kids be unwound? Who will turn on them? What will happen? In the book Unwind the government canceled the abortion law, and made The Bill of Life. If the kids were out of control their parents could sign an unwind order from the ages 13-18 and have them shipped to a harvest camp. Here all their body parts would be harvested and given to someone else. The characters were all unwinds, Conner wanted to escape. He found a safe place and traveled from place to place until he ended up at the graveyard. While at the graveyard, he was trying to help the admiral and ended up getting sent to a harvest camp. He earned respect from the other unwinds but in the end to Chop Shop blew up and Connor ended up in the hospital. At the end of the book Connor ended back at the graveyard as the leader. Connor changes by learning to think before he acts because he never did learn to think before he acts. Connor had a past of doing stupid things and getting into trouble.
